About the Author

MEGHAN O'GIEBLYN is a writer who was raised and still lives in the Midwest. Her essays have appeared in Harper's Magazine, n+1,The Point, The New York Times, The Guardian, The New Yorker, Best American Essays 2017, and the Pushcart Prize anthology. She received a B.A. in English from Loyola University, Chicago and an MFA in Fiction from the University of Wisconsin-Madison. She lives in Madison, Wisconsin with her husband.

"Interior States :Essays" takes a hard look at Fundamentalism in America from its roots to the current state of affairs with a vice president who abides all things done by a faithless president.The author’s essays about growing up in evangelical Protestantism are eye opening; she argues against the faith she was brought up in with clarity and grace. It was during her second year at Bible school when she read "The Brothers Karamazov" and entertained for the first time the problem of hell, how evil could exist with a benevolent God. When O’Gieblyn finally stopped calling herself a Christian in her early twenties, it was because “being a Christian no longer meant anything…the gospel became just another product someone was trying to sell me.”Her essay on "Hell" pointedly asks how Christian churches today can remain silent "on the problem of evil, for fear of becoming obsolete,” calling it a willingness to tailor Christian values to whatever the audience wants.However, it is O'Gieblyn's essay "Exiled," that I find so remarkable. It certainly clears the fog (in my mind) about Mike Pence's acceptance to serve under Trump. Now I know why he smiles so benignly when Trump throws out his falsehoods—Pence is a Daniel-like figure behind the throne of an "angry, irrational king," waiting patiently for the political path to clear so he can return America to its Christian roots.

This is the only book I've found that addresses the history and evolution of spinning wheels in a comprehensive way. Because this is a book about the spinning wheel, and not spinning in general, she only touches on the spindle as the beginning of the history of the wheel. Baines writes in an accessible style, beginning with the earliest known evidence of spindle spinning, carrying through to the history of the wheel, it's changing form and rapid geographic spread from the orient to the middle east to Europe. Baines also explores the reasons why wheels evolved in different ways in various locations, and in a fascinating chapter, discusses the influence the hand wheel had on emerging mechanical spinning- and vice versa. Interspersed with this is discussion of the social elements: the lives of spinners, their place in a changing economy (spinning and weaving was an industry long before the development of mechanized spinning and weaving). There are many illustrations, all discussed in detail in the text. A fascinating book that helped me to understand the origins of my craft, and to feel kinship with spinners in past centuries.

I enjoyed Ian Stewart’s history of mathematics, entitled “Significant Figures: The Lives and Work of Great Mathematicians”, which includes the biographies of some notable mathematicians. I found that this book had a great format, combining character insights into people, a history of a subject as well as a powerful approach to teach people about mathematical concepts and how they interconnect. I particularly liked the way Stewart was able to describe concepts such as Turing's insights into computation and Gödel’s insights into logic and link them together with their lives. I also enjoyed the way that he explained the construction of non-Euclidian geometries and how this, of course, is built one person on top of another.The book has lots of great character insights into why these individuals were so brilliant. I particularly liked the story of how Carl Gauss was able to quickly solve a simple addition problem -- summing up all the numbers from one to 100 very quickly -- that is easily grasped now but which clearly illuminates his brilliance as a young child.Overall, I would highly recommend this book to anyone. I think a little knowledge of mathematics is useful because some of the sections benefit from some understanding of calculus, group theory, &c.

The book’s subtitle “The Lives and Work of Great Mathematicians” is certainly quite appropriate, giving the book dual themes – their lives and their work. Twenty-five mathematicians are featured spanning two and a half millennia.I thoroughly enjoyed the mini-biographies that the author has provided; I was familiar with several of these people, but some, I had never heard of. I found the author’s prose in these stories to be clear, friendly, often lively and quite engaging.Regarding the book’s second theme, the mathematical accomplishments of these mathematicians, I had mixed feelings. As a physicist, I am familiar with (at least some of) the works of those who contributed, at least in part, to applied mathematics/physics, e.g., Newton, Euler, Fourier, etc., and I thoroughly enjoyed the author’s descriptions of their (practical) works. However, a great many of the mathematicians featured also made significant contributions to branches of mathematics whose practical applications are not obvious and, in some cases, are totally non-existent, i.e., in fields of pure mathematics including number theory. In his technical discussions, the author pulls very few punches with regards to the free use of jargon attributable to the matters being discussed, without including too many definitions/explanations of terms. Thus, in many of the pure mathematics discussions, I was at a disadvantage and much of what was presented was over my head.However, overall, I did find the book interesting and worth the read.
